Demonstration of watershed segmentation on simulated surface topography data
Mohd Fauzi Ismai1, Talib Ria Jaafar2, Nor Hidayawati Mohd Zaini3, Nuraini Che Pin4.
Surface texture comprises of many features of interest, which may or may not be essential
for surface functional requirements. Features on the surface topography data refers to the
peak, pit and the relationship between them; instead of the point on the valleys only.
Hence, the objective of this paper is to demonstrate the watershed segmentation on the
simulated surface topography data. Watershed segmentation is applied on the selected
areal surface texture to determine the regions of the features of the hill and dales. The
segmentation of the features is developed by using MATLAB. The developed application is
then validated with the simulated topography data. The application’s result on the
simulated data shows that, the watershed segmentation method works as intended.
